Klaken J339 Valdur J339-BK Overview

The Klaken J339 Valdur J339-BK is a rugged, budget-friendly EDC folding knife built around a 3.42" stonewashed D2 blade, a black Micarta handle, and a proven liner lock. A smooth flipper deployment, single-position pocket clip, and included nylon pouch make it an easy everyday carry or outdoor companion at 7.95" overall and 3.6 oz.

Specifications

Brand Klaken
Model J339 Valdur (J339-BK)
Blade Length 3.42" (8.7 cm)
Blade Thickness 0.118" (0.3 cm)
Closed Length 4.52" (11.5 cm)
Overall Length 7.95" (20.2 cm)
Blade Steel D2 tool steel
Blade Finish Stonewashed
Handle Material Black Micarta
Lock Liner Lock
Opening Manual, flipper
Pocket Clip Single-position
Carry Nylon pouch included
Weight 3.6 oz (102 g)

Frequently Asked Questions

What blade steel does the Klaken J339 Valdur J339-BK use?

The Klaken J339 Valdur J339-BK uses D2 tool steel in a stonewashed finish. D2 is a high-carbon, high-chromium steel prized for excellent edge retention and toughness at an accessible price.

How long is the blade on the Klaken J339 Valdur J339-BK?

The Klaken J339 Valdur J339-BK has a 3.42" (8.7 cm) blade with 0.118" stock, measuring 4.52" closed and 7.95" overall when open.

How do you open and close the Klaken J339 Valdur J339-BK?

The Klaken J339 Valdur J339-BK opens manually via a flipper tab and locks open with a liner lock. To close it, push the liner aside with your thumb and fold the blade back into the handle, keeping fingers clear of the edge path.

What handle material does the Klaken J339 Valdur J339-BK have?

The Klaken J339 Valdur J339-BK features black Micarta scales — a resin-bonded laminate that grips well even when wet and develops character with use — plus a single-position pocket clip.

Is D2 good knife steel for the Klaken J339 Valdur J339-BK?

Yes. D2 gives the Klaken J339 Valdur J339-BK strong wear resistance and long edge life. It is a semi-stainless steel, so wipe the blade dry after wet use and oil the pivot occasionally to keep it looking its best.
